WebThe ICE BofA US High Yield Options-Adjusted Spread is a measure of the risk premium demanded for high yield (junk) bonds. Recent Fedspeak suggest that the terminal rate … notts apc hypothyroidismWebFollowing is the Credit Spread Formula-. Credit Spread = (1 – Recovery Rate) (Default Probability) The formula simply states that credit spread on a bond is simply the product of the issuer’s probability of default times 1 minus possibility of recovery on the respective transaction.
